The difference is first stainless Steel is more expensive than (blued) chrome molly. Most of the top barrel makers use stainless steel for most of their top end barrels because they are a little softer and a lot easier to hand lap to get a super smooth finish on the inside of the barrels they will also tell you they either can't or won't spend the time and effort to get their chrome molly barrels as smooth. Either way the barrels come smoother in stainless steel. Most shooter go for the stainless steel. They break-in a little faster and for that reason they clean easier quicker. Stainless steel barrels don't last any longer. There are people that think the stainless steel barrels are more accurate that is not true a good chrome Molly barrel will shoot every bit as good as a good stainless steel barrel. More of the top class shooters use stainless steel barrels than chrome molly barrels therefore everybody think they are better. The reason for this is most top barrel makers make a lot more stainless steel barrels than they do chrome molly so there are a lot more available. Both are good the choice is up to you.
